Understanding the Unique Billing Challenges of Urgent Care Centers
Medical billing within urgent care settings differs significantly from billing in primary care practices or specialty clinics. One of the biggest challenges involves managing high patient volumes. Unlike scheduled appointments in traditional practices, urgent care centers often experience unpredictable patient traffic. Billing teams must process large numbers of claims quickly while maintaining accuracy and compliance. Efficient workflows and advanced billing technologies are essential for keeping pace with demand. Another significant challenge is insurance verification. Urgent care centers frequently serve walk-in patients who may have limited knowledge of their insurance benefits. Front-desk staff must verify eligibility, identify coverage restrictions, and determine patient financial responsibility before services are rendered. Failure to collect accurate insurance information can result in claim denials and delayed reimbursements. Coding complexity further complicates urgent care billing. Providers often perform multiple procedures during a single patient encounter, including evaluation and management services, laboratory testing, imaging studies, injections, and minor surgical procedures. Each service requires precise coding to ensure proper reimbursement. Even minor coding errors can trigger denials or audits. Denial Management Strategies for Urgent Care Centers
Claim denials remain one of the most significant financial challenges facing urgent care providers. Every denied claim represents delayed revenue, additional administrative work, and potential financial loss. Common denial causes include coding inaccuracies, eligibility issues, missing documentation, duplicate claims, and payer-specific policy violations. Effective denial management requires a systematic approach focused on prevention, analysis, and resolution. The most successful denial management programs begin with identifying root causes. Billing specialists analyze denial trends to determine whether specific errors occur repeatedly. For example, a pattern of denials related to incorrect modifiers may indicate a need for coder education or workflow improvements. By addressing underlying issues, providers can significantly reduce future denials and improve reimbursement performance. When denials do occur, prompt action is essential. Professional billing teams review denial notices, gather supporting documentation, and submit appeals when appropriate. Many denied claims can be successfully overturned if corrected and resubmitted within payer deadlines. Reducing Revenue Leakage in Urgent Care Facilities
Revenue leakage occurs whenever a healthcare organization fails to collect reimbursement for services that were legitimately provided. In urgent care environments, revenue leakage can result from coding errors, incomplete documentation, missed charges, denied claims, or inefficient billing processes. Even small financial losses can accumulate over time and significantly impact profitability. One common source of revenue leakage involves incomplete charge capture. Because urgent care providers often perform multiple services during a single encounter, it is possible for certain procedures or supplies to be omitted from the final claim. Professional billing teams conduct regular audits to ensure all billable services are accurately documented and submitted. Key Performance Indicators Every Urgent Care Center Should Monitor
Successful revenue cycle management requires continuous measurement and performance monitoring.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) help urgent care centers evaluate the effectiveness of their billing operations and identify opportunities for improvement. By tracking financial performance metrics, providers can make data-driven decisions that strengthen profitability and operational efficiency. One of the most important KPIs is the first-pass claim acceptance rate. This metric measures the percentage of claims accepted by insurance carriers upon initial submission without requiring corrections or resubmissions. High acceptance rates typically indicate strong coding accuracy, effective documentation practices, and efficient billing workflows. Organizations utilizing professional urgent care coding services often achieve significantly better first-pass performance than facilities relying solely on internal resources. Another critical KPI is Days in Accounts Receivable (A/R). This metric measures how long it takes for providers to receive payment after services are rendered. Lower A/R days generally indicate efficient billing processes and healthy cash flow. Monitoring denial rates, collection percentages, net reimbursement rates, and patient payment trends can also provide valuable insights into revenue cycle performance.
